AEROTEK IS HIRING A 1st and 2nd SHIFT QUALITY INSPECTOR IN New Port Richey, FL!
Responsibilities
- Perform general floor inspections on production parts throughout the manufacturing process.
- Conduct visual inspections to identify defects, nonconformities, or cosmetic issues on parts.
- Use precision inspection tools such as micrometers, calipers, micro gauges, and hand gauges to verify part dimensions.
- Complete first piece, first article, and last piece inspections to validate production runs against specifications.
- Read and interpret blueprints to determine required dimensions, tolerances, and inspection criteria.
- Document inspection results accurately and clearly, following established quality procedures.
- Identify and report nonconforming parts or conditions to appropriate personnel.
- Work closely with production staff to support quality standards on the manufacturing floor.
- Maintain inspection tools and equipment in good working condition and use them safely.
- Support inspection activities related to injection molded components as needed.
Additional Skills & Qualifications
- Plastic injection molding experience is a plus.
- Experience inspecting injection molded components is beneficial.
- Familiarity with general quality inspection practices in an open shop environment.
- Ability to adapt to working around machinery while maintaining focus on quality.
- Strong communication skills to clearly report inspection findings.
